If you plan on wiping the paint off, or painting something over it later on then you don’t need to seal the chalkboard. There is an option to seal with a matte varnish, which I highly recommend if you want to seal your paint. You can seal the painted chalkboard if you want to make it permanent, but keep in mind that it may remove the vintage chalky look, and you may end up with a glossy chalkboard. If you decide to use acrylic paint, your paint may pop out more depending on the colors you choose from. If you use chalk paint, you will end up with a complete matte look. You can use acrylic paint to decorate a chalkboard as well as chalk paint. You will need 1/3 cup of Plaster of Paris, 1/3 cup of water, and some acrylic paint. Some people also use baby powder, baking soda, and even calcium carbonate, but Plaster of Paris is great because it also has many other uses in the art world. This is the secret ingredient that will hold and make your acrylic paint look chalky. If you want to use your acrylic paint, but want a chalk paint look, well you’re in luck because it’s totally doable! What you will need is Plaster of Paris. You can apply a few layers of acrylic paint if you need to, but two coats should do the job. However, if you are making or painting your surface with chalkboard paint, you will need to make sure it’s fully dry before using acrylic paint.Īlways make sure the surface is dry and clean to ensure you don’t accidentally paint over debris or dust. Make sure the surface is dry and dust free before you start. If you are applying acrylic paint on an already painted chalkboard, then you can just simply start painting. Yes! You can definitely use acrylic paint on a chalkboard, whether it be on a regular chalkboard, or painted with chalkboard paint. Since acrylic paint is a water-based type of paint, it’s non-toxic, sometimes washable, and is preferred by many artists. Acrylic paint is an extremely popular type of medium, because it can be used on practically every surface.
